Summary:Distributed Agile Software Development blends the principles of agile to geographically separated teams and thereby combines the quality benefits of Agile Software Development with cost benefits of Distributed Software Development. Distributed Agile Software Development brings along new risks that arise due to the difference in working principles of Agile Software Development and Distributed Software Development. Identifying and managing these risks on time improves the quality of the software product and reduces the overall development cost. This work presents a novel Artificial Intelligence based framework for managing risks in Distributed Agile Software Development. The proposed framework will help the practitioners to timely identify and deal with associated risks and thereby reduce the cost and development time.
